The Nativity: From the Gospels of Matthew and Luke
Little Brown & Co (Juv), 1996
Attractive illustrations accompany the Nativity story
Ruth Sanderson has created rich and detailed illustrations for this small book which presents the Nativity story from the gospels of Matthew and Luke in the Revised Standard Version. Sanderson's paintings are reminiscent of traditional Eastern Orthodox icons and Roman ...

Billy and the Boingers Bootleg (Bloom County Book)
Berke Breathed
Little Brown & Co (Juv Pap), 1987
Bloom County 4.... or 5.... depends on....
Okay - Bloom County Babylon, the 4th Bloom County book was really a compilation of material contained in the first 3 books. So.... depending on if you want a chronological collection of the BC Strips, or to complete ALL of the BC Books, this is either the 4th or 5th ...
